Sylvania Platinum Limited

("Sylvania", the "Company" or the "Group")

ESG Report to 30 June 2025

Sylvania (AIM: SLP), the platinum group metals ("PGM"), chrome producer and developer, with assets in South Africa, is pleased to release its Environmental, Social and Governance ("ESG") Report 2025, for the year ended 30 June 2025. The full report is available for download from the Company's website www.sylvaniaplatinum.com.

ESG Highlights

·      The Company achieved the best overall safety performance in its history in FY2025, including the achievement of one full year injury-free for combined Eastern Operations and Doornbosch reaching the milestone of 13-years Lost-Time Injury ("LTI") free in June 2025;

·      Sylvania paid over 156.6 million South African Rand to community-based suppliers in FY2025;

·      Enhanced water utilisation measurement achieved, enabling more reliable tracking of water flows and losses;

·      Significant progress made on more sustainable, efficient, and cost-effective ways to rehabilitate tailings storage

facilities ("TSFs");

·      Meaningful progress in diversity and inclusion, with women now representing 29% of the workforce and 40% of the Board;

·      FY2025 saw 4,893 internal training interventions, a 48.93% increase year-on-year, plus increased community- based employee training and 27 bursaries awarded; and

·      Enhanced climate disclosure with the introduction of Scope 3 emissions reporting, improving transparency and aligning Sylvania with emerging global ESG standards.

About Sylvania Platinum Limited

Sylvania Platinum is a lower-cost producer of platinum group metals ("PGMs") (platinum, palladium and rhodium) and chrome with Operations located in South Africa. The Sylvania Dump Operations ("SDO") is comprised of six chrome beneficiation and PGM processing Plants focusing on the retreatment of PGM-rich chrome tailings materials from mines in the Bushveld Igneous Complex ("BIC"). The SDO is the largest PGM producer from chrome tailings re-treatment in the industry. In FY2023, the Company entered into the Thaba Joint Venture ("Thaba JV") which comprises chrome beneficiation and PGM processing Plants, and is treating a combination of run of mine ("ROM") and historical chrome tailings from the JV partner, adding a full margin chromite concentrate revenue stream. The Group also holds mining rights for PGM projects in the Northern Limb of the BIC.
